This document provides specific instructions for modifying the decorative plate and the door lock mechanism on Dometic REF 10-Series refrigerators. Before beginning, verify your specific model number against the list provided in the manual to ensure these instructions apply to your unit.
Changing the Decorative Plate
The decorative plate can be replaced or installed by following the specific thickness requirements. Ensure your panel meets the following criteria:

- Thickness range: The panel must be either 1.2–1.5 mm or 1.6–3 mm thick.
- Combined thickness: The total thickness (a + b) must be between 1.6 mm and 3 mm.
Installation Steps:
- Remove the existing decorative strip or panel as shown in the diagrams.
- Slide the new decorative plate into the designated slot.
- Ensure the plate is fully seated and the decorative trim is reattached securely.
Changing the Door Lock
The door lock mechanism can be modified or reversed. Follow these steps carefully:

- Locate the lock mechanism on the door.
- Follow the numbered sequence in the diagram to remove the lock components.
- Rotate the lock mechanism 180 degrees as indicated by the arrows in the diagrams.
- Reinstall the components in the reverse order of removal, ensuring all parts click into place.
